Use Cases-Account structure-Campaign Mangement

Number of APIs: 7

  1. Update multiple campaigns using BATCH POST {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ns?ids[0]={{campaign_id1}}&ids[1]={{campaign_id2}}

  2. Search for Campaign using criteria GET {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ns?q=search&search.campaignGroup.values[0]=urn:li:sponsoredCampaignGroup:{{campaigngroup_id1}}

  3. Update Campaign Using campaignId POST {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ns/{{campaignId1}}

  4. Delete campaign Using campaign Id DELETE {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ns/{{campaign_id1}}

  5. Fetch a Campaign using Campaign ID GET {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ns/{{campaignId1}}

  6. Delete multiple campaigns using BATCH DELETE {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ns?ids=List({{campaign_id1}},{{campaign_id2}})

  7. Archive a Campaign POST {{baseUrl}}/adAccounts/{{adAccountsId}}/adCampaigns/{{campaign_id1}}